The most common is a tub/shower blend succeeded by a walk-in shower and traditional bathtub. However, there is an increasing demand for standalone showers due to the area they save in smaller bathrooms and their ease of use with the aged segment.

What is the finest wideness and longness for a walk-in shower?
Anything less than 30" wide is not recommended, as it's challenging to get in and out of. A 36" wide shower is typically a good wideness for many people. To the extent that length goes – the standard size is 5 feet, but anything from 3 to 6 feet in length would be fine if you have the room.

What is the finest flooring for bathrooms?
Ceramic tile is almost always a top-notch choice for floors in bathrooms and other wet areas. The grout lines can be closed off with a coating that will help ward off mold expansion and water harm. Marble is an alternate good flooring choice for bathrooms. If the marble is processed, it can be used outdoors as well. With a polished surface, and nice sheen, it needs fewer maintenance than various stone kinds. Stone slabs or pavers will persist basically forever but are not always very comfy on bare feet (because of their rough boundaries).

What is the best substance to place on bathroom walls?
You can put up wallpaper, but it's not straightforward to change later. Wall paint and vinyl-coated wallpaper are less hard to take off if you decide to sell your home in a several years.
How do you produce more storage in a bathroom?
Install cabinets and shelving. Utilize your walls, the ceiling, or a edge of the room for storage whether you can't insert a cabinet. A fabric shower basket dangled from hooks is another idea and it gives a simple way to eliminate extra jumble while adding décor at the same time.
